Is the 318 Magnum a Hemi?

The engine was predominantly used in Dodge trucks and Jeep Grand Cherokee’s from 1992 until 2003 when it was replaced by the Hemi. The 5.2 Magnum is also commonly referred to as the 318 Magnum due to its 318 cubic inches of displacement.

How much horsepower does a 5.2 liter V8 have?

The 5.2 L was the first of the Magnum upgraded engines, followed in 1993 by the 5.9 L V8 and the 3.9 L V6. At the time of its introduction, the 5.2 L Magnum created 230 hp (172 kW) at 4,100 rpm and 295 lb⋅ft (400 N⋅m) at 3,000 rpm.

Is the 5.2 V8 a good engine?

5.2 Magnum Reliability The 5.2 Magnum used in Dodge trucks and Jeeps is a pretty solid engine. It doesn’t suffer cylinder head cracks to the same extent that the 5.9 Magnum does. Additionally, the internals and major engine components seem to be fairly strong and adequate for good longevity at stock power levels.

Can I swap a 4.7 Dodge Magnum with a 5.2 Dodge Magnum?

you will have to change out the transmission, cooling system and all wiring and everything else. nothing is compatible between the 4.7 and the 5.2/5.9.

When did dodge come out with the 318 engine?

The 318 is the most common version of the A engine, produced from 1957 through 1967 when it was replaced in all markets by the LA 318. Only Plymouth used this 318 in 1957 and 1958, but it was shared with the other Chrysler divisions from 1959 on.

When did Dodge discontinue the 318?

The Dodge 318 V-8 engine was produced by the Flint, Michigan-based Chrysler Corporation, now Chrysler LLC, from 1967 to 2002. The 318 was not just limited to Dodges, but also powered Plymouth and Chrysler cars as well. The engine was remarkably efficient, durable and proved to be Chrysler’s mainstay for many of its vehicles over the decades.
